Performance modelling power consumption and carbon emissions for Server Virtualization of Service Oriented Architectures (SOAs)
Server Virtualization is driven by the goal of reducing the total number of physical servers in an organisation by consolidating multiple applications on shared servers. Expected benefits include more efficient server utilisation, and a decrease in green house gas emissions. However, Service Oriented Architectures combined with Server Virtualization may significantly increase risks such as saturation and Service Level Agreement (SLA) violations.
